Anthony Daste

Anthony is a Northern California native who graduated from San Jose State University as a Public Health major and a Dance minor. He started off as a street/freestyle dancer and has trained in multiple styles. In 2016, he joined an urban choreography team called VIP San Jose where he started to compete at different competitions. He also used to be on the Academy of Villains and was the president of San Jose State’s hip hop club.

 

Currently, he is a choreographer/co-founder of Commonality San Jose. He has showcased and competed at various dance shows such as World of Dance Finals, Vibe dance competition, Evolution Urban Dance Competition, and had the opportunity to be cast in a dance movie called “No Dance, no life” with the Academy of Villains. He currently teaches Intermediate Hip Hop at Montage Dance Productions. 

 

Slogan:

"I teach to inspire and educate beyond movement. I want people to leave my class understanding more than dance and knowing how they can apply my teachings to help them grow outside of class." - Anthony Daste
